Asphalt Lot Paving in Savannah, GA
Asphalt lot paving services involve the installation, repair, and resurfacing of asphalt surfaces used for parking areas, driveways, and other property access points. This service is suitable for a variety of projects, including new lot construction, expansion of existing parking areas, or restoring worn and cracked asphalt to improve safety and appearance. Property owners often seek asphalt paving to create durable, smooth surfaces that can withstand regular vehicle traffic, while also ensuring proper drainage and long-term performance.
Before requesting asphalt paving, property owners typically want to understand the scope of the project, including the size of the area to be paved, the condition of the existing surface, and any necessary preparation work such as grading or base repairs. Clarifying these details helps ensure the appropriate materials and techniques are used to achieve a level, long-lasting asphalt surface that meets the property's needs.

Asphalt Lot Paving Questions
What types of projects are suitable for asphalt paving? Asphalt paving is ideal for driveways, parking lots, and pathways on residential and commercial properties in Savannah and nearby areas.
How long does an asphalt parking lot typically last? With proper installation and maintenance, asphalt parking lots can last 15 to 20 years or more.
Is asphalt paving suitable for small residential driveways? Yes, asphalt is a common choice for residential driveways due to its durability and smooth finish.
What should property owners know before starting an asphalt paving project? Proper surface preparation and quality materials are essential for a long-lasting asphalt surface on any property.
